/*
Name: Phoebe Swaine
Date: 13/04/23
Project: Scrabble board-game
*/
import java.io.BufferedReader;
import java.io.FileNotFoundException;
import java.io.FileReader;
import java.io.IOException;
import java.util.Arrays;
import java.util.HashSet;
import java.util.HashMap;
//Game class for Scrabble - Handles the game logic
public class Game {
char[][] scrabbleBoard;
private static HashSet<String> dict;
private static HashMap<String, String> boardScores;
public Game() {
this.initGame();
this.initBoardScores();
try { this.initDict();
} catch (FileNotFoundException e) {
System.err.println("FileNotFoundExpectation: " + e);
}
}
// TODO: change display logic - view class handle the chars??
// TODO: actual board only has tiles or is empty
private void initGame() {
this.scrabbleBoard = new char[15][15];
for (int i = 0; i < 15; i++) {
for (int j = 0; j < 15; j++) {
this.scrabbleBoard[i][j] = ' ';
}
}
}
//Initializes the dictionary - text file from 'https://github.com/redbo/scrabble/blob/master/dictionary.txt'
private void initDict() throws FileNotFoundException {
Game.dict = new HashSet<String>();
BufferedReader dictReader = new BufferedReader(new FileReader(("words.txt")));
try {
String line = dictReader.readLine();
//add all words from words.txt to hashset
while (line != null) {
dict.add(line.toUpperCase());
line = dictReader.readLine();
}
} catch (IOException e) {
System.err.println("IOException : " + e);
e.printStackTrace();
}
}
/*
Initializes the map that stores special scores for cells
*/
private void initBoardScores() {
Game.boardScores = new HashMap<String, String>();

public static String getBoardScoreForTile(String ref) {
if (Game.boardScores.containsKey(ref)) {
return Game.boardScores.get(ref);
} else {
return null;
}
}
/*
returns the char on the board at (row, col)
@param row row index
@param col col index
@return char at (row, col)
*/
public char getTileOnBoard(int row, int col) {
return this.scrabbleBoard[row][col];
}
/*
@param word input to be validated
@return boolean if word is valid
*/
public static boolean validateWord(String word) {
return dict.contains(word.toUpperCase());
}
/*
returns string representation of the board
@return Game string object
*/
public char[][] getScrabbleBoardClone() {
char[][] boardClone = new char[15][15];
for (int i = 0; i < 15; i++) {
for (int j = 0; j < 15; j++) {
boardClone[i][j] = this.scrabbleBoard[i][j];
}
}
return boardClone;
}
/*
Adds the new word to the board
@param move
*/
public void placeWordOnBoard(move move) {
//assumption that the word is valid
if (move.isValid) {
String word = move.word;
int row = move.startRow;
int col = move.startCol;
for (int i = 0; i < word.length(); i++) {
if (move.direction == move.RIGHT) {
//increase row value to add word to the right
System.out.println("Adding the word to the right.");
this.scrabbleBoard[row][col+i] = word.toUpperCase().charAt(i);
} else if (move.direction == move.DOWN) {
System.out.println("Adding the word down.");
//increase col value to add word down
this.scrabbleBoard[row+1][col] = word.toUpperCase().charAt(i);
}
}
}
}
}
